The Gower Peninsula Coastline

Reynoldston's location on the Gower Peninsula provides unparalleled access to breathtaking coastal scenery. Dramatic cliffs, sandy beaches, and hidden coves offer endless opportunities for exploration and photography. Take a leisurely stroll along the coast path, breathe in the fresh sea air, and marvel at the power and beauty of the Atlantic Ocean.

Three Cliffs Bay

This iconic bay, with its three dramatic limestone cliffs guarding a pristine sandy beach, is a must-see. The views are simply stunning, and it's a perfect spot for a picnic, a swim (weather permitting!), or simply relaxing and soaking up the atmosphere.

Eat Like a Local: Must-Try Foods in Reynoldston, Wales, United Kingdom

Indulge in the hearty flavors of Welsh cuisine. Sample traditional dishes like Welsh Cawl (a hearty lamb stew), laverbread (a seaweed delicacy), and bara brith (a fruitcake). Many local pubs and cafes offer delicious, authentic meals made with fresh, local ingredients. Don't forget to try some local Welsh cheeses and ales!

Best Time to Visit Reynoldston, Wales, United Kingdom

The best time to visit depends on your preferences. Summer (June-August) offers warm weather and long daylight hours, perfect for exploring the coastline and enjoying outdoor activities. However, it's also the busiest time of year. Spring and autumn offer milder weather and fewer crowds, while winter provides a unique, quieter experience, ideal for those who enjoy bracing walks and dramatic coastal scenery. Always check the weather forecast before you go.
